"Next Patient Please"
It was the second day Melody had been in town, covering for her mentor Dr Stein who was taking a long overdue holiday. Dr Stein was the only paediatrician at Green Oaks, a small inland town whose population was tight knit. Melody was born in this town, grew up here, fell in love and experienced her first heartbreak here.
Now a paediatrician, she lived in the city but came back to visit her parents who still lived in Green Oaks yet for the next two weeks she was back to living at home and it all felt comforting to her, familiar. This was proving to be a busy day as there seemed to be a flu bug going around, resulting in dozens of unhappy little patients; runny and stuffy noses, coughs and tears were the order of the day. What she did not expect to see was a tall man with a face that had once dominated her teenage dreams walking through the office door with a five year old girl in his arms. A man she had once loved beyond reason and had a planned a future. A man who had, four months into college, called her to tell her he has impregnated another woman and was very sorry for cheating on her. That was ten years ago. She was no longer a heartbroken eighteen year old, she was Dr Scott.
